On September 18, 2024, the UPSC Engineering Services Examination (ESE) announcement for 2025 was formally made public. The application procedure was launched with this notification and was open until October 8, 2024. In order to sit for the exam, candidates must first take the preliminary exam on February 9, 2025, and then the main exam on June 26, 2025. The notification gives candidates thorough information about eligibility requirements, test trends, and other pertinent factors. There are 167 vacancies for the IES 2024 examination, according to the Union Public Service Commission (UPSC). Numerous engineering specialities, such as civil, mechanical, electrical, electronics, and telecommunications engineering, are represented among these positions. The exam for these positions is set for February 18, 2024, and the notification was made public on September 6, 2023.

No. The Union Public Service Commission has released the official calendar for the 2026. The IES 2026 notification will be released on September 17, 2025. The IES 2026 applications will be filled online only. The candidates should note that the last date to apply online will be October 7, 2025. The UPSC will also provide the IES 2026 application correction facility also.

The Commission will conduct the IES 2026 Prelims exam on February 8, 2026.

The decision between Woxsen University and IES Normandie for an MBA programme is based on personal preferences and career aspirations. Prestigious French business school IES Normandie places a high emphasis on global business education, has strong ties to the European economy, and an international viewpoint. India's Woxsen University offers a modern curriculum with an emphasis on entrepreneurship in addition to first-rate facilities. Woxsen University excels in offering a vibrant learning atmosphere and strong linkages to the Indian corporate scene, whereas IES Normandie may give more prospects in Europe and worldwide exposure. Consultancy emerged as the top sector during IES MCRC internships for the batch 2021-23. As per records, 19% of students were placed in the Consultancy sector. The second in the sequence was the Pharmaceutical sector. See the below pie chart depicting the sector-wise distribution of IES Mumbai internships 2021-23:

IES MCRC Internships 2023

NOTE: The ‘Others’ category represents the combined data of multiple sectors such as Financial Service, Retail, IT, and Fintech.

The number of students placed during the final placements 2025 at IES MCRC is not known as of yet. The following table represents the overall and course-wise students placed data for IES MCRC placements 2024:

ParticularsMBA Placement Statistics (2024)MBA (PM) Placement Statistics (2024)Overall Placement Statistics (2024)
Students registered10728135
Students placed9128119
